| very Weird fact: If you ftp in from a Solaris host, and try the exact same
| sequence, it all works fine.  I don't have easy access to any other FTP
| clients to try.

the difference might be how the client is handling the "ls".

the FTP protocol has at least two different mechanisms for
requesting a directory listing (LIST, NLST).  so the solaris
client might be implemented differently from the first client
you tried.  i think the original idea was that one would be
"human readable" and the other would be "machine readable"
(for implementing things like mget).
